Before the upcoming elections to the state Duma political parties are stepping up resources to enlist the support of the voter. However, the financial capacities of parties are very different. While one parties harder finding money on the campaign, others continue a comfortable existence in the first place — at the expense of public funds, and sometimes due to hidden foreign funding. The experts of the movement “Voice” has published a report on the sources of funding of parties. “Novaya Gazeta” found the study very interesting and recounts the most interesting.

State aid

Now count on financial support from the budget can party garnered in the last Federal election more than 3% of the vote. Such a barrier among non-parliamentary parties then crossed the only “Apple”. The amount is calculated as follows: one vote in the last election gives political Association 110 rubles of state funds for the year. (Until 2015, this amount was halved.)

The authors of the report point out the huge difference in income: “United Russia” in 2015 “earned” (apart from budget) of 5.18 billion rubles, which is 3-4 times more KPRF, LDPR or “Fair Russia” and 20 times the income of the “Yabloko” (250 million).

The income of the “Yabloko” consist of 99% of budget funds, while less than all of the state depends on United Russia — budget funds make up only 68.6 percent of its income.

 

Donors

By law, funds to the party funds you can list of public organizations, foundations, private sponsors and companies. The latter often become members of the scheme so-called “hidden budget financing”. What does it mean?

In the financial reports of political organizations often included the names of the companies who voluntarily donate considerable sums for the benefit of the party. But it is not always the case only in support of the course. Experts “Voices” found a pattern: become a donor of the ruling party, the company begins to receive regular contracts.

For example, “VSK Mordoviya”, donated in 2015 to Fund “United Russia of 500 thousand roubles, has received contracts totaling more than 1.7 billion rubles. But “Magnitogorsk iron and steel works, a subsidiary of the company which was donated to the United Russia 30 million rubles for 2015-2016 received 91 state contract for a total amount of about of 5.16 billion rubles.

According to “the Voice”, donation to the funds of political parties is about 10% of the amount of the future contract.

“Among donors of the political parties received in 2015-2016 relatively large contracts, more than 90% accounted for the company, donor of the “United Russia”, the remaining funds were a legal entity, the funding parties, “Patriotic” orientation”, — experts say “Voice”.

 

Foreign funding and private donations

In addition to grants and subsidies, some parties, contrary to the law, continue to receive money from foreign companies, say the authors of the report. Externally, these transactions look legal: registered in Russia, the company donates money to the party that is not against the law, but sometimes it turns out that their ultimate owners in different times were offshore companies registered in Cyprus, British virgin Islands and the us state of Delaware.

Covert foreign funding, experts believe “the Voice” received “United Russia” “Fair Russia” and “Rodina”. In fairness, in some cases, a portion of the funds or the entire amount received was returned to the donors. For example, of the 17 million who sacrificed subsidiary company group TNS Energo, 2 million was later returned to one of the donors, and “Mangazeya Stroy” party of power back 1 million of the three million donations.

Large donations to the party sometimes get from very specific individuals. some of this paragraph is the main source of income: for example, 80% (25 million) funds the “Civil platform” are the donations of citizens. From them 5 people (including the political strategist of the party) have listed 21 million rubles. There are other cases. For example, 19-year-old resident of Yekaterinburg was supported by the Communist party a contribution of 100 thousand rubles, and in Karelia from three people at the age of 21-22 years, donated the “Fair Russia” for 73 thousand rubles.

 

What the money is spent

Experts are sure that the usedonmost of the money the party needs to spend directly on political activities: advocacy, campaigning, public events, etc. But in reality from all parties eligible to nominate candidates without collection of signatures, this model holds only the liberal democratic party, which for this purpose has allocated nearly 68% of its budget.

More willing party spend on the maintenance of Central authorities and regional offices. Last year on staff salaries and office rent, the Communist party has spent almost 60% of all the money (860 million), “United Russia” focused on the regions and contributed to their content of 45.5% (versus 13.2% on the salary of Federal leadership).

Most in percentage (55.6 per cent) from the budget of the party on the content of the governing bodies were spent by the party “Parnassus”. In campaign and party activities, the management has allocated 4.8% (472 thousand rubles).

DIRECT SPEECH

Stanislaw Andreychuk,

leading expert of the movement “Voice”, head of the regional centre “transparency international” in Barnaul:

“Very direct relationship between the amount held by a party, and their chances in the upcoming elections we will not see, because in addition to party Finance, there are campaign funds that are generated additionally. For example, “Civil force” according to the documents, last year was not a penny of income, and if not for the election Fund, you do not quite understand, what money it will go to the polls.

The “United Russia” and the Communist party a large amount of “stash” for this year, and it gives them additional opportunities. In the long-term benefits from the “rich” parties, of course, there are those who receives money from the budget over the next four to five years will be able to expand the unit to include the regional network. But how to spend the money — at the discretion of each party.

Still, the big problem is covert foreign funding of parties, but in comparison with last year the situation has improved.

After our last year’s report, the CEC recognized that in some moments they are flawed and have started to take action. As far as I know, the current composition of the CEC started this topic: signed a contract with Rosfinmonitoring, Federal tax service. The CEC has no powers to personally verify such information, and their previous responses, we realized that the tax worked with financial documents of the parties carelessly.

Alas, the law has no clear provisions on how and where you can spend the party funds. I think it is a matter for great debate about how legal this is: why are we, the citizens, who pay taxes, have to chip in money for the maintenance of the leadership of several parties, for which we even the election didn’t vote? It turns out that we, albeit against our will, but at their own expense are the fruit of bureaucracy in political organizations.”
